Market Overview: The Sterile Injectable Contract Manufacturing Market plays a pivotal role in the pharmaceutical and biotechnology industries, providing specialized services for the production of sterile injectable drugs. Contract manufacturing organizations (CMOs) in this market offer comprehensive solutions, including formulation, filling, and packaging, to pharmaceutical companies seeking efficient and compliant manufacturing processes.
Meaning: Sterile Injectable Contract Manufacturing involves the outsourcing of the manufacturing processes related to sterile injectable drugs. These drugs, often critical for patient care, require a sterile environment throughout the manufacturing process to ensure product quality, safety, and regulatory compliance.

Segmentation: The Sterile Injectable Contract Manufacturing Market can be segmented based on:
- Type of Injectable: Small Molecules, Biologics.
- Service Type: Fill-Finish Manufacturing, Aseptic Filling, Lyophilization, Packaging.
- Therapeutic Area: Oncology, Infectious Diseases, Autoimmune Diseases, Others.
Category-wise Insights:
- Biologics Manufacturing: The manufacturing of sterile injectable biologics, including monoclonal antibodies and gene therapies, represents a significant portion of the market. CMOs specializing in biomanufacturing have a competitive edge in this segment.
- Fill-Finish Services: Fill-finish manufacturing services, involving the filling and packaging of injectable drugs, are crucial for the final stages of production. CMOs offering reliable and efficient fill-finish solutions are in high demand.

Market Key Trends:
- Advanced Aseptic Technologies: The adoption of advanced aseptic technologies, including isolator systems and restricted-access barrier systems (RABS), is a prevailing trend in sterile injectable manufacturing to enhance product safety.
- Personalized Medicine Production: The increasing focus on personalized medicine, including individualized therapies and gene therapies, influences sterile injectable manufacturing trends. CMOs are adapting to cater to the evolving landscape of personalized medicine.
